Title: Dedicated Data Engineer (Knowledge Graph Specialist)

Locations: Bethesda, MD - preferred but will consider other locations on a case-by-case basis

Onsite: Expected to go onsite (into a SCIF) 3 - 5 days per week

Clearance: TS/SCI - Must be willing to get a CI Poly

***MUST have an Active Top Secret clearance and be willing to get an SCI w/ CI Poly***

***If you do NOT have a US Citizenship or a Security Clearance issued by a US Government Customer, we will likely not get back to you. It is a REQUIREMENT of the job.***

What we are hiring:

Intelligence analysts with technical know-how to represent the next generation of object-based intelligence globally. People who want to change the current landscape of tools available to other analysts globally and help make sense of an ever-changing world.

An ideal candidate has a background in the intelligence community, specifically in defense intelligence, and knows how to tackle problems around operational readiness and disposition. Ability to work with technical teams is a must. Must have the ability to effectively communicate ideas about how to utilize the system we're building to other analysts, senior stakeholders, and other parties. Preferred candidates also have the ability to help build training materials in conjunction with the technical team.

Required Technical Skills (MUST HAVES):
  • Must have a Bachelor's degree and 1.5+ years of professional experience
  • A strong grasp of graph theory, data modeling, and a passion for structuring complex, multi-dimensional relationships
  • Expertise with graph database solutions, such as Anzograph, Neo4j, or Amazon Neptune
  • Familiarity with database query languages including Cypher, SQL, and SPARQL
  • Familiarity with scripting languages including Python and shell scripting
  • Familiarity with Linux systems including RedHat-based distributions
  • Experience working with software development teams in any capacity
  • Experience working in and willingness to work in classified government environments
  • Experience developing on MacOS, Windows, and Linux
